A beta release of the open source NetBeans 6.5 IDE is being offered by Sun Microsystems on Wednesday.
The beta, available for download, has features such as an IDE-wide "QuickSearch" shortcut, a more user-friendly interface, and an automatic Compile on Save feature.
Developers can build applications for Java, PHP, C/C++, Groovy, Grails, Ruby, Ruby on Rails, and AJAX. Web frameworks are supported such as Hibernate, Spring, and JavaServer Faces. The Glassfish application server and databases also are supported.
The beta release serves as an update to a Milestone 1 release offered for NetBeans 6.5. The new version officially is called NetBeans 6.5 Milestone 2.
The general release of NetBeans 6.5 previously has been set for Oct. 2. Sun also has expressed intentions to eventually add Python language support to NetBeans.
Also on Wednesday, Jaspersoft is announcing the availability of business intelligence development capabilities for NetBeans and upgraded business intelligence support for Sun's MySQL database. The Jaspersoft iReport plug-in for NetBeans is a graphical report and dashboard tool for JasperReports, which is an open source reporting product. The plug-in had been available in a beta release since December.
Reports are delivered via JasperServer, which includes a repository, dashboards, scheduling, and reporting.
Jasper for MySQL version 3 is an optimized version of the Jaspersoft Business Intelligence Suite that features capabilities of Jaspersoft version 3.
